融合多家CDN是一种通过整合多个内容分发网络(Content Delivery Network,简称CDN)服务商的资源和能力,以实现更高效、稳定的内容分发服务的策略,在现代互联网环境中,随着用户对网站性能和可用性要求的不断提高,单一CDN往往难以满足所有需求,因此融合多家CDN成为了一种有效的解决方案,以下是关于融合多家CDN的详细解释:
一、核心特点与优势
1、全球覆盖:
融合CDN通常拥有全球范围内的节点分布,能够为世界各地的用户提供快速的内容访问。
2、负载均衡:
通过智能调度算法,融合CDN能够将用户请求分配到最佳的节点,以减少延迟和提高响应速度。
3、冗余和可靠性:
融合多家CDN可以减少单点故障的风险,提高服务的可靠性。
4、成本效益:
企业可以根据实际需求选择最优的CDN资源,从而降低成本。
5、灵活性和可扩展性:
融合CDN能够根据业务需求快速扩展或缩减资源,适应不同的流量需求。
6、性能监控和优化:
提供实时的性能监控和分析,帮助企业优化内容分发策略。
7、安全性增强:
通常提供额外的安全功能,如DDoS攻击防护、数据加密和访问控制。
8、内容智能管理:
能够根据用户行为和内容特性,智能地缓存和分发内容。
9、API和集成:
提供API接口,方便企业将CDN服务集成到现有的IT架构中。
10、多协议支持:
支持多种协议,包括HTTP/HTTPS、HTTP/2、WebSocket等,以适应不同的应用场景。
11、边缘计算:
可以在网络边缘执行计算任务,减少延迟,提高处理速度。
12、自适应流媒体:
对于视频内容,能够根据用户的网络条件动态调整视频质量,提供最佳的观看体验。
二、实现方式与技术要点
1、智能DNS解析:
通过DNS服务器根据用户的地理位置、网络状况等因素,将用户请求分配到最合适的CDN节点上。
2、Anycast路由:
使用单个IP地址将流量分配到多个不同的服务器节点上,确保用户请求被路由到最近且最可用的节点。
3、地理定位:
根据用户的物理位置来优化内容分发,确保用户从最近的CDN节点获取内容。
4、成本控制:
比较不同CDN提供商的价格和服务,选择最适合的方案。
5、冗余备份:
通过多家CDN提供商的协作来确保内容的高可用性和可靠性。
6、类型优化:
针对不同的内容类型选择最适合的CDN提供商,如静态内容和动态内容的优化。
三、案例分析
1、Netflix:
Netflix使用自建的CDN(Open Connect)和第三方CDN(如Akamai、Level 3等)相结合,通过智能DNS解析和负载均衡技术,将用户请求分配到最适合的CDN节点。
2、LinkedIn:
LinkedIn使用多家CDN(如Akamai、Fastly等)相结合,通过智能DNS解析和负载均衡技术,提供高性能和高可用性的服务。
四、注意事项与挑战
1、复杂的基础设施:
融合CDN需要更多的服务器资源和管理复杂性。
2、成本可能增加:
需要购买新硬件或租用服务器空间,以及管理多个供应商带来的额外成本。
3、供应商数量膨胀:
增加更多的供应商可能会提高安全漏洞风险。
4、技术能力要求:
需要具备自动执行系统和实时监控的技术能力。
五、FAQs
1、什么是融合CDN?
融合CDN是一种通过整合多家CDN服务商的资源和能力,以提供更高效、稳定的内容分发服务的网络技术。
2、为什么选择融合CDN?
融合CDN可以提供全球覆盖、负载均衡、冗余和可靠性、成本效益、灵活性和可扩展性、性能监控和优化、安全性增强、内容智能管理、API和集成、多协议支持、边缘计算以及自适应流媒体等优势。
3、如何实现融合CDN?
可以通过智能DNS解析、Anycast路由、地理定位、成本控制、冗余备份以及针对不同内容类型的优化等技术手段来实现融合CDN。
六、小编有话说
融合多家CDN是提升网站性能和可用性的有效策略,但也需要企业在实施过程中充分考虑其复杂性和挑战,选择合适的CDN提供商、合理配置和管理多家CDN资源、以及持续监控和优化内容分发策略都是成功实施融合CDN的关键,希望本文能为企业在选择和实施融合CDN时提供有益的参考和指导。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1466364.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复